Wow the difficulty keeps going down Smiley.
I love it i can mine more BTX.. and wait for the price to go up in a few months

Since BTX profitability is not displayed on whattomine and cryptowarz, miners don't bother mining it.. but i do and i'm really happy with it


Still not nearly the most profitable coin. At least on NVIDIA it looks currently like this:

You have to consider the fact, that this tool uses standard ccminer, not spmod2, so in reality it would be +20%.... And if you also count in the airdrops every week + the fact that BTX is near the bottom now so we expect the price to go up soon... I think it is a smart move to mine btx now.
Yes, on my desktop it's not using spmod2, because it's not really usable while mining with spmod2. But even with the 20% it's still much more profitable to mine s.th. else and buy BTX. The airdrops are in no way related to your mining profits.

Why wouldn't they be related?  Ex, if one mined 20 BTX and put them in a registered address before airdrop, they would receive 1 BTX (5%) which could then be compounded if left place.
Because it's the same if you mined it or if you bought it. So not related to mining.
Let's say you mined 20 BTX in one day and get 5% you are in total at 21BTX. If you mine, let's just say purely hypothetical, another coin for 0.052227BTC (this would be the actual top coin) for one day. If you buy BTX for
that you currently get 30BTX + 5% airdrop = 31,5BTX
If you look at it this way you get even more airdrop through mining the top coin and buying BTX because you will accumulate BTX faster by buying than by mining it directly.


Good point.  I was looking at in terms of what specifically mining BTX would yield, factoring in air drop.  That ahashpool graphic you provided is very informative; are you using 1080 ti?
Yes that's a 1080 TI without any OC or UC.
